SanDisk Extreme III SDHC 30MB/s Edition – For Nikon D90 Video

August 26, 2008 By Eric Reagan

Rob Galbraith has a nice summary of the need and limitations of these new 30MB/s SD cards from SanDisk.  He points out that the cards were designed to compliment the D90’s need for speed and will only function in other DSLRs as 20MB/s cards (the cap for SDHC).

SanDisk’s press release details further:

SanDisk Corporation (NASDAQ: SNDK) today set a new speed record of 30 megabytes per second1 for SDTM flash memory cards with the introduction of the SanDisk Extreme® III 30MB/s Edition line of SDHCTM Cards. The new cards, expected to be available worldwide in September in 4-gigabyte (GB)2, 8GB and 16GB capacities, are designed to deliver peak performance when used with the new digital single-lens reflex (DSLR) camera, Nikon D90.
